Particle physicists have only observed or inferred left-chiral fermions and right-chiral antifermions engaging in the charged weak interaction. Even in the case of the electrically neutral weak interaction, which can engage with both left- and right-chiral fermions, in most circumstances two left-handed fermions interact more strongly than right-handed or opposite-handed fermions, implying that the universe has a preference for left-handed chirality. WebDec 20, 2024 · In particular, the existence of SWCNTs with different chiralities seriously limits the further development of high-performance SWCNT-based nanodevices. Thus, the controllable synthesis techniques of SWCNTs with desired diameter or chirality have been highly desired, especially in the past ten years, as has an in-depth understanding of the ...
